Welcome to the Hollingbourne Cricket Club website
The club was formed in 1870 and used to play in Eyhorne Street. The club moved to Pilgrims Way some years later.
We are affiliated to the England & Wales Cricket Board and the Kent Cricket Board. We play League Cricket on Saturdays in the Invicta League and on Sundays in the Kent Village League. We also play Midweek friendly matches, and also organise and play in a local Twenty/20 Competition.
In 2008 we started our Junior Section and had a good response with 30 Juniors registering for Coaching. In 2009 we grew that number to 40+ by linking in with a local club - LBH and our local school. We currently have 6 UKCC Level 2 qualified Coaches and during the 2009 season we achieved ECB's Clubmark Accreditation.
Clubmark is the ‘kite’ mark promoted by our governing body, the ECB, to protect the welfare of young people in Cricket. This is important to us to achieve this status as it confirms that in the eyes of the ECB we are a safe, effective, and child/youth friendly club.
